Three dead, homes burnt in Zamfara bandit raid — Report

Gunmen have killed three people and set several houses and silos ablaze in Dangoro village, Bungudu Local Government Area of Zamfara State.

 

The spokesperson for the state police command, Yazid Abubakar, disclosed this in a statement issued on Monday.

 

He said the attack occurred on March 28, 2026, at about 10:30pm, when a group of armed bandits wielding AK-47 rifles attacked Dangoro village via Nahuche District.

 

According to Abubakar, the assailants invaded the community, shooting sporadically and setting houses and silos on fire.

 

“Upon receipt of the report, a joint team of police operatives and vigilante members swiftly mobilised and responded to the scene.

 

“The team engaged the hoodlums in a gun duel, successfully repelling the attack and forcing the criminals to flee into the bush with possible gunshot injuries.

 

“Regrettably, three people lost their lives during the incident, including a member of the Community Protection Guard.

 

“Additionally, five people sustained gunshot injuries, while four others suffered varying degrees of burn injuries.

 

“The bandits also burnt several houses, silos containing food grains, and livestock, including goats,” he said.

 

Abubakar further explained that all injured victims had been evacuated to the Federal Medical Centre, Gusau, where they are currently receiving treatment and responding positively.

 

He added that the command has intensified efforts to track down and apprehend the perpetrators of the attack.

 

Abubakar also said that the Commissioner of Police, Ahmad Muhammad, assured residents of the command’s unwavering commitment to safeguarding lives and property.

He urged residents to remain calm, vigilant, and continue to cooperate with security agencies by providing credible information.
